Have you ever wanted to record your family recipes and food stories? Do you like to play with words and ideas?

Join food writer Barbara Sweeney and Museums of History NSW curator Dr Jacqui Newling for a special exploration of food and memory in the atmospheric kitchen at Vaucluse House. Inspired by family stories and culinary collection items from our most cherished historic houses – including Vaucluse House, Susannah Place and Rose Seidler House – this immersive program invites you to explore your food heritage and family recipes.

Barbara Sweeney is an accomplished teacher, and her food writing workshops are both playful and challenging. She believes we all have a story to tell and is highly skilled at guiding people through their hesitations and procrastination to write freely and joyously.

Finish the workshop with a shared sweet treat and a cup of tea.
